Sarah’s practice encompasses a diverse range of disputes work, with a focus on commercial disputes and international arbitration. She has advised and acted for multinational corporations, directors and shareholders, and high-net-worth individuals. She has appeared at all levels of the Supreme Court of Singapore and before leading arbitral institutions.
- Advising and acting for a prominent real estate group in a dispute over its purchase of a commercial property valued at S$260 million, in which the seller is challenging the sale on various grounds including duress and undue influence;
- Advised and acted for a renowned charity in an ICC arbitration against a former staff member for breaches of confidence, and successfully resisted applications by the former staff member to stay the arbitration proceedings and for the confidentiality of the arbitration proceedings to be lifted;
- Advised and acted for a Chinese industrial refrigeration company in an SIAC arbitration brought against its supplier in a dispute over whether the components supplied were developed according to contractual specifications;
- Successfully obtained a world-wide freezing (Mareva) injunction for the value of US$20 million (covering assets spanning Singapore, the US, Canada and Indonesia) in connection with a high-net-worth family dispute;
- Acted for and advised the Liquidators of SC Aetas Holdings Pte Ltd. The Company raised funds to build a new building in Bideford Road and subsequently ran into financial difficulties;
- Acted for the Liquidators of the Envy Companies in successfully defending an appeal by an investor seeking to retain fictitious profits paid from one of the largest Ponzi schemes in Singapore;
- Advised and acted for a hotelier, in defending a claim brought by a building and construction company, for the alleged repudiatory breach of a contract for the refurbishment of several hotel rooms;
- Acted for Multi-Chem Limited, a listed company, in respect of investigations into red flags raised by auditors and taken up by SGX; and
- Successfully acted for a landlord in obtaining damages and indemnity costs against its tenant for failure to pay rent.
